State Laws
The body of law enacted by each state or territory in the United States governing local affairs.
Discrimination
Unjust or prejudicial treatment of different categories of people or things, especially on the grounds of race, age, or sex.
Federal Laws
Regulations established by the national government that apply throughout the country, superseding state and local laws where there is conflict.
Equal Rights
The principle that all individuals are entitled to the same rights and legal protections, without discrimination on any grounds.
